Spanish 8 Students

The 8th grade program is the second year of a two year sequence, which allows students to complete, level I of the language at the middle school. Students who successfully complete both years may take level II at the high school. Students continue their study of the language by expanding and building on their knowledge from 7th grade. The focus of the program is to have the students use the target language to communicate about their daily lives and activities.

This class meets everyday for 45 minutes, all year long. Students use a textbook and are required to keep an organized notebook. Students will receive homework most nights as well as preparing for quizzes, tests, and projects based on the Maine State Learning Results in Interpersonal, Presentational, Interpretive, Language Comparison and Cultural Practices and Perspectives.

During the year, students will gain an insight into other cultures through readings, music, food, art and various projects. Students are encouraged to use the target language whenever possible in the class.
